Summary

NBC News broadcast a live press event featuring President Trump meeting with the president of Lebanon. Discussion covered Israeli actions near Lebanon, pressure on Iran, Hezbollah, US strikes on Iranian nuclear facilities, and Lebanese army support. Trump also addressed US border policy, DC crime reductions, the 2026 World Cup, Venezuela, and tariffs.

Editorial Assessment

The segment accurately conveyed official US government statistics on historically low border encounters and documented US/Israeli strikes damaging Iranian nuclear sites in 2025-2026. Framing highlighted policy successes with limited counterpoints or independent analysis. Viewers miss detailed sourcing on crime or Venezuela claims and context on ongoing regional ceasefires. Hyperbolic language around '0 crossings' and total degradation of Iran exceeds nuanced official reports of 'extremely low' numbers and 'years' of setback.

Key Moments

verified

14 consecutive months with zero illegal border crossings and releases

DHS and CBP reports confirm 11-15 months of zero releases and apprehensions under 9,000/month, down 94-97% from prior administration.

missing context

US strikes inflicted damage on Iranian nuclear sites that will take Iran 20-25 years to rebuild

2025-2026 strikes hit Natanz, Fordow, Isfahan; assessments range from months to years of setback per DIA and officials.

unsupported

Washington DC crime reduced by 92%

No independent corroboration in available data for the specific 92% figure during the period referenced.

verified

2026 World Cup was the most successful ever with five times the business and no crime or protests

Trump and reports describe it as record-breaking in scale and largely incident-free.
